7.9.3 General information
Do not take apart, open or deform rechargeable batteries.
Do not short-circuit rechargeable batteries.
Do not store rechargeable batteries in a box or draw as this can pose
hazards where they can short out each other or be shorted out by an-
other conductive material.
Use rechargeable batteries for their intended purpose and protect
them from damage.
Keep rechargeable batteries away from children.
Seek immediate medical attention if rechargeable battery compo-
nents are swallowed accidentally.
Use rechargeable batteries only in those applications for which they
are intended.
If possible, take the rechargeable battery out of the machine when it
is not being used.
If possible, take the rechargeable battery out of the machine when it
is being loaded and transported.
In the event of prolonged storage, remove the rechargeable battery
from the machine and store it in the original battery transport box.
Store in a dry and well-ventilated room.
Observe storage temperature, see technical data on page 56.
Dispose of properly.
In the event of fire:
Decommission the machine immediately.
Remove injured persons and others from the danger zone.
Stay away from vapors and gases, observe wind direction!
Extinguish only with water, do not use a direct stream of water.
7.10 Specific charger-related safety instructions
7.10.1 External influences
Avoid penetration of water into the battery charger.
Only use the battery charger indoors and keep away from rain and
moisture.
If it is not possible to avoid working in a damp environment, a residual
current circuit breaker must be used.
Always keep the battery charger clean and dry.
Do not expose the battery charger to any mechanical impacts.
If the connections are dirty, clean these with a dry and clean cloth.
Protect the connection cable from any aggressive media (e.g. oil),
sharp edges or moving machine parts.
Do not operate the battery charger in freezing temperatures, see
Technical data on page 56.
The battery charger may not be exposed to heat (e.g. direct sunlight)
or fire.
